WebMetaphors, Analogies, and Similes. One of the highest level thinking strategies is the use of metaphors. When a student can find ways to compare two or more dissimilar things, they are really using their brains. For example, when teaching main idea and supporting details, I compare it to a table and legs. Diction ... Web2 nov. 2024 · Literacy skills are all the skills needed for reading and writing. They include such things as awareness of the sounds of language, awareness of print, and the relationship between letters and sounds. Other literacy skills include vocabulary, spelling, and comprehension. Here are some simple definitions of some of the skills contained …

Web11 jan. 2024 · While literary devices express ideas artistically, rhetoric appeals to one’s sensibilities in four specific ways: Logos, an appeal to logic; Pathos, an appeal to emotion; Ethos, an appeal to ethics; or, Kairos, an appeal to time. These categories haven’t changed since the Ancient Greeks first identified them thousands of years ago.
